  • question: Is the infrared sensor affected by environmental conditions?

    répondre: Yes, the performance of infrared sensors can be influenced by various environmental factors such as ambient light conditions, surface reflectivity of obstacles, and temperature. For optimal performance, it’s important to conduct preliminary tests in the intended operational setting to calibrate the sensor accordingly. This consideration ensures the robot's effective navigation and obstacle detection capabilities remain reliable across different environments.
  • question: Can the sensor be used outdoors?

    répondre: While the Adjustable Infrared Obstacle Detection Sensor is primarily designed for indoor use, it can be used outdoors with caution. Factors like sunlight interference and varying surface materials can impact its performance. If your maze robot is intended for outdoor use, it’s important to test the sensor thoroughly in the relevant environment and ensure it is shielded from direct sunlight to maintain accuracy in obstacle detection.
